Moving forward, leaving the adrenaline fuelled earlier weeks of the coronavirus crisis behind us, where weekends merged into the working week, towards a steadier phase, inevitably our thoughts and planning turn to recovery. We know through that knot in our stomachs that services for children, particularly those of us in children’s social care, will start to see an increase in referrals when schools start to re-open fully and colleagues in our universal services begin to return to some semblance of normality and see more children again. ADCS has been heavily involved in discussions with the Department for Education about recovery and certainly in the East Midlands region we are using our twice weekly virtual DCS meetings and weekly REACT calls to begin discussing the likely scenarios ahead of us.
